How much does it cost to rent an apartment in South Shore Queens?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| South Shore Queens Studio Apartments | $3,856 | $1,575 | $6,090 |
| South Shore Queens 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,929 | $1,000 | $8,040 |
| South Shore Queens 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,405 | $1,800 | $10,000+ |
| South Shore Queens 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,717 | $2,421 | $10,000+ |
| South Shore Queens 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,450 | $1,300 | $4,500 |
